Thomas Creek
Thomas Creek is a stream in Linn, Oregon. Thomas Creek is situated nearby to the village Jefferson, as well as near the suburb Draperville.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Jefferson is a city in Marion County, Oregon, United States. It is part of the Salem Metropolitan Statistical Area. The population was 3,327 at the 2020 census. Jefferson is situated 3½ miles northwest of Thomas Creek.

Millersburg is a city in Linn County, Oregon, United States. It was originally the name of a station on the Southern Pacific railroad line, which was named for a local farming family. The population was 1,329 at the 2010 census. Millersburg is situated 4½ miles west of Thomas Creek.

Crabtree is an unincorporated community and census-designated place in Linn County, Oregon, United States. As of the 2010 census, it had a population of 391. Crabtree is situated 4½ miles southeast of Thomas Creek.
